Solent Stevedores’ Electric Forklifts at the Port of Southampton

Solent Stevedores has invested £1m in a new fleet of 35 fully electric counter balance fork lift trucks to help lower emissions at the Port of Southampton.

The fully electric, next generation fork lift trucks are equipped with the latest safety technology, as well as with additional driver enhancements designed to improve comfort and reduce driver fatigue.

This £1 million investment by Solent Stevedores will help to ensure that the company can maintain their excellent level of service delivery and reliability as record growth in cruise at the Port of Southampton continues.

It’s estimated that this year Solent Stevedores will provide in-port services for 400 cruise ships, handling around 2.7 million suitcases and loading more than 100,000 tonnes of ship’s stores.
